#1da106 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#1da106 is composed of 11.4% red, 63.1% green and 2.4%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 82% cyan, 0% magenta, 96.3% yellow and 36.9% black. It has a hue angle of 111.1 degrees, a saturation of 92.8% and a lightness of 32.7%. #1da106 color hex could be obtained by blending #3aff0c with #004300. Closest websafe color is: #339900.

Shades and Tints of #1da106

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#020a00 is the darkest color, while #f7fff6 is the lightest one.

Tones of #1da106

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#535453 is the less saturated color, while #1da106 is the most saturated one.
